Question 1011866: Mia sells T-shirts from a booth at a market.
She pays $30 to rent the booth. Each T-shirt
costs her $1.50, and she sells them for $7.50
each.
Her goal is to make $200 after she pays for
the booth and the T-shirts.
What is the minimum number of T-shirts
Mia must sell to reach her goal?

Answer by Boreal(15235)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
Cost function=revenue function -200.
C=30+1.5x
R=7.5x
30+1.5x=7.5x-200
230=6x
She needs to sell 39 shirts
Check:
$30+39*1.5=$30+58.50=$88.50
39*7..5=$292.50
